18 month data from the phase 1b single-arm, open-label clinical trial of AAV-GDNF in #Parkinsons by @ask_bio has been published; N=11; Well tolerated & associated with numerical stability (mild cohort; <5 yrs since dx) & improvement (moderate cohort) https://t.co/5sO1XOTqNz

New data reveals region- & disease-specific changes in the levels of lipid species; Alterations in the levels of specific phosphatidylserine species in brain areas most affected in #Parkinsons; a-synuclein at mitochondria–ER membranes alters lipid metab. https://t.co/j5UtqHntKS

New research from @ZivGanOr & colleagues finds that plasma glucosylceramide levels are regulated by ATP10D & are not involved in #Parkinsons pathogenesis; Results "suggest that altering GlcCer levels is not a good therapeutic method for GBA1-PD" https://t.co/T2BtE8GE4n
